Abstract: An additive material has a composition of from about 50 wt % to about 95 wt % of a base material and a curing agent when required to cure the base material, and from about 5 wt % to about 50 wt % of a weight percentage of boric acid and a weight percentage of sodium bicarbonate, wherein the weight percentage of boric acid is greater than the weight percentage of sodium bicarbonate. The composition optionally further includes a weight percentage of magnesium oxide.
